Transaction 6814427a131661063e5fbc9942cbee81800656650347fc94b642f2c892d49421
1 Input
1 Output
-
6814427a131661063e5fbc9942cbee81800656650347fc94b642f2c892d49421:0
- value
- 2468794
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25b01c5aea559267c252be00b5b5b99e1b48e93c OP_EQUAL
- address
- 358Hu2o6J2NrZKhV2QQNir9hnMGLEPKEAk